The Versatility of Brass Metal Mesh Applications and Benefits
Brass metal mesh has gained significant attention in various industries due to its remarkable properties and versatility. It is a woven material made from brass, an alloy consisting primarily of copper and zinc. This unique composition grants brass metal mesh not only aesthetic appeal but also practical advantages that make it suitable for a wide range of applications. In this article, we will explore the characteristics, applications, and benefits of brass metal mesh.
Characteristics of Brass Metal Mesh
Brass metal mesh exhibits several distinct characteristics that set it apart from other materials. One of its most notable features is its excellent corrosion resistance. The zinc in brass helps to prevent oxidation, allowing it to withstand harsh environments without succumbing to damage. Moreover, brass metal mesh offers a moderate level of flexibility, making it easy to manipulate and shape according to specific needs.
Another crucial characteristic is its conductivity. Brass is more conductive than many other metals, making brass mesh an excellent choice for applications requiring electrical conductivity. Additionally, brass mesh boasts a beautiful golden hue that adds a decorative touch to various products and designs, appealing to aesthetic sensibilities in architectural and interior design applications.
Applications of Brass Metal Mesh
Brass metal mesh finds utility in numerous fields, including construction, automotive, aerospace, and even art and design. In the construction industry, brass mesh is frequently used as an architectural feature, such as in facades and interior partitions. Its aesthetic quality combined with its strength makes it an ideal choice for enhancing the visual appeal of buildings while providing structural integrity.
In the automotive industry, brass mesh is often utilized in filtration systems. Its fine openings allow for effective filtration of liquids and gases, ensuring that engines and other parts operate efficiently. Moreover, brass mesh is used in heat exchangers, where its thermal conductivity helps in the efficient transfer of heat.
The aerospace industry also benefits from brass metal mesh, as it is used in various applications, including as a component of radar systems and in shielding. The electromagnetic shielding properties of brass help protect sensitive electronic components from interference, ensuring optimal performance in demanding environments.

Furthermore, brass metal mesh is increasingly popular in artistic endeavors. Artists and designers utilize brass mesh to create intricate sculptures, decorative screens, and unique furnishings. Its combination of flexibility and durability allows for innovative designs that push the boundaries of traditional materials.
Benefits of Using Brass Metal Mesh
The advantages of using brass metal mesh are manifold. First and foremost, its durability ensures a long lifespan, making it a cost-effective option in the long run. While the initial investment may be higher compared to more conventional materials, the resistance to corrosion and wear reduces the need for frequent replacements.
Additionally, the aesthetic appeal of brass metal mesh cannot be overstated. The warm tones of brass can complement a variety of design styles, from modern minimalism to classical elegance. This versatility in design makes it an excellent choice for both functional and decorative applications.
Another significant benefit is the ease of maintenance. Brass mesh can be cleaned effortlessly, maintaining its appearance and functionality over time. Regular cleaning prevents tarnishing and keeps the mesh looking new, which is particularly important in high-visibility applications.
Lastly, because brass is recyclable, using brass metal mesh contributes to sustainability efforts. When the material reaches the end of its lifecycle, it can be melted down and reformed into new products, reducing waste and conserving natural resources.
